Buy Category B Driving License

A commercial class B license allows you drive a vehicle that weighs more than 26,001 pounds and tow trailers up to 10,000 pounds. It also lets you earn CDL endorsements, which give you additional permission to operate certain types of vehicles or carry specific cargo.

A class B CDL permits you to drive straight trucks, city buses, tour buses, segmented buses and dump trucks with small trailers. A class C CDL allows you to operate combined vehicles that are not covered by Class A or Class B and to transport hazardous materials.

Obtaining your commercial learners permit (CLP) is the first step toward earning your Class A or Class B, or Class C CDL. With the CLP you can practice driving a commercial vehicle while wearing a CDL holder sitting in the seat of the passenger. Once you have obtained your CLP you can then take the CDL knowledge and skills test.

Once you have the CDL you can drive a single car weighing 26,001 pounds and up or a tow vehicle weighing 10,000 pounds or less. You can also obtain endorsements or extra permits to operate vehicles that have additional weight limits and specifications. Some endorsements include Passenger, which allows you to operate buses with passengers, Tank, Comprar Carta de condução categoria B (https://imoodle.win/wiki/20_Fun_Informational_Facts_About_Buy_Category_C_Driving_License) which permits you to drive trucks that carry liquid cargo, and Hazmat which permits you to transport hazardous materials.
